Transaction 43cdc6d4b2250a51b4f592086e41c709f790a739de40b55f7e42bf2355c765db
1 Input
1 Output
-
43cdc6d4b2250a51b4f592086e41c709f790a739de40b55f7e42bf2355c765db:0
- value
- 21695746
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 859484d02726dfadc50fc6a2f156e01c4c7a4927 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1DBJnnH92Q1DKshmsZr6tRwQeBrckzH7Yk